Neutrino-deuteron scattering in effective field theory at next-to-next-to-leading order

Abstract
We study the four channels associated with neutrino-deuteron breakup reactions at next-to-next-to-leading order in effective field theory. We find that the total cross section is indeed converging for neutrino energies up to 20 MeV, and thus our calculations can provide constraints on theoretical uncertainties for the Sudbury Neutrino Observatory. We stress the importance of a direct experimental measurement to high precision in at least one channel, in order to fix an axial two-body counterterm.
